After spending two months in Torrox Spain last winter I returned in love with the vibrant colors of Andalusia. I had reflected here on the heat, the various shades of reds and fuchsias of the bougainvillea I love very much. They are often grown in most remarkable and tight spaces and cast unique shadows on white stucco walls. I admire very much the lively architecture and gardens of this unique place.

Dorota Mariola Goede B.Arch.
Nanoose Bay, British Columbia
Born in Wrocław, Poland, Dorota studied architecture before immigrating to Canada in 1981. She earned her Bachelor of Architecture from the University of Toronto and later taught at Mohawk College in Hamilton. Now retired in Nanoose Bay, she enjoys painting, gardening, and sailing. Trained in drawing, watercolor, acrylic, and oil, Dorota finds joy in creating works that reflect natural beauty and bring color to life.
